The Sartorial Spectrum: From Saris to Streetwear
In corporate offices and urban universities, practical fusion wear dominates. Indian women have masterfully combined elements of Western and Indian clothing—such as pairing a traditional long tunic ( kurti ) with denim jeans, or styling ethnic silver jewelry with contemporary dresses. There is also a strong wellness movement sweeping through India. Women are blending traditional Ayurvedic superfoods (like turmeric, amla, and ashwagandha) with global health trends (like quinoa, avocados, and plant-based diets) to maintain holistic health.
